Wide-band absorption in leucosapphire irradiated by neutrons
Description
Changes in absorption spectra of leucosapphire crystals irradiated by fast neutrons after the action of Hg-lamp radiation, annealing at various temperatures and γ-radiation are studied. In all the investigated crystals the γ-radiation causes the appearance of wide-band absorption with maxima about 225 and 400 nm
